Light: Full to Partial Sun
Days to Maturity: 90
Planting Depth: 1/2"
Plant Spacing: 24"
Height: 12"
Size: 18"-24"
Disease Resistance: N/A
A long season cabbage. For earlier heads, ready in late summer, sow indoors 6 weeks before last frost. Transplant healthy seedlings when there are 2 sets of true leaves, 24 inches apart. For fall harvest, start seeds 100 days before first fall frost. Cabbage requires well drained, fertile soil and plenty of water. Harvest once heads are full, heavy, and solid. The size of the heads will vary.
Tips: Cabbage plants do better when planted near herbs like dill and rosemary. Avoid planting cabbage near strawberries, tomatoes, or pole beans.
